I hate to do this but i have to sell my bug. I have loved this little volkswagen but just dont have room for so many cars so it has to go.

So as stated it is a 1969, that means its still a standard, not super. it has a 1500 or 1600 SP engine, its right on the edge of when they switched. It does have the IRS rear suspension. the car has been nothing but fun and brings a smile to my face everytime i drive it.

I had planed on painting it this summer so i was slowly getting it ready, doing body work. the only work still needed to be done is a dent in the rear apron, a little patch of rust in the right rear quarter (smaller then a credit card) and the front apron bottom, where the spare tire would sit is rusted out but i have a replacement for it that goes with the car. also there is a leaky brake cylinder, not a big deal but just takes one pump on the brakes to get good pressure, I have a new cylinder and also a new flex line for it just not installed yet. thats pretty much all the bad there is too it.

heres a list of all the stuff done to the car:
Empi H4 conversion headlights
Empi T-Handle short shifter
2.5" drop spindles
2" narrowed adjustable height front beam
retractable 3pt seat belts
Rear pop-out windows
1.5" Flared Fiberglass Fenders front and rear
Vdo gauge set with tach, head temp, oil temp, oil pressure and voltage
Floor pans have been replaced on Passanger side, solid on driver still
New ball joints for lowered front end (not installed yet)
body gasket set (hood handle door handle brake lights ect)
Pertronix flame thrower electric ignition (eliminates points)
Pertronix Flame thrower coil to match ignition
low mount exhuast

the car has just been nothing but fun as i said. oh it has a CLEAN TITLE of course.looking for about 2200 but a member could probably get it for a little less
